Rad18 Polyclonal Antibody
Sizes: 50µl, 100µl
Catalogue Numbers: BS7565-50, BS7565-100
Product: 1mg/ml in PBS with 0.02% sodium azide, 50% glycerol, pH7.2
Swiss-Prot: Q9NS91
Host: Rabbit
Reactivity: Human, Mouse, Rat
Applications: WB, IHC, IF/ICC
All Applications: WB,1:500 - 1:2000 | IHC,1:50 - 1:200 | IF/ICC,1:50 - 1:200
Background: The protein encoded by this gene is highly similar to S. cerevisiae DNA damage repair protein Rad18. Yeast Rad18 functions through its interaction with Rad6, which is an ubiquitin-conjugating enzyme required for post-replication repair of damaged DNA. Similar to its yeast counterpart, this protein is able to interact with the human homolog of yeast Rad6 protein through a conserved ring-finger motif. Mutation of this motif results in defective replication of UV-damaged DNA and hypersensitivity to multiple mutagens.
Purification and Purity: The antibody was affinity-purified from rabbit antiserum by affinity-chromatography using epitope-specific immunogen and the purity is > 95% (by SDS-PAGE).
Storage and Stability: Store at 4°C short term. Aliquot and store at -20°C long term. Avoid freeze-thaw cycles.
